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Essentials of Metal Polishing - Most often, the finishing of metal is wanted for appearance and clean-room applications. It really is one of the more recognized solutions simply because of its success in improving upon the overall beauty of the items, as an example, cookware, motor vehicle parts or motorbike parts. Besides that, a lot of clean-rooms want a burnished finish in an effort to lower the porosity of the metal surfaces which can cause particles to collect and contaminate. A great demonstration of this use could be in a vacuum chamber. There are several strategies to finish metals, and let's have a look at some of the steps required. Metal may be burnished electromechanically, chemically, by hand, or with specialized buffing machines. A finishing compound or paste can be applied, that may include dolomite, chromium oxide, chalk, limestone, aluminum o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, because of its poor th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scosity is just about the time intensive. On the other hand, products made of non-ferrous metals tend to be more amenable to finishing, since they require the lower amount of treatments.
Whenever a high processing quality is just not important, higher pad speeds should be employed. A lesser pad speed is required if a good quality mirror finish is important. Polishing buffs covered in compound are greatly affected by specific pressures on the surface of the finishing pad. The strength of the surface pressure might be increased within certain guidelines, although placing beyond the maximum measure of load not just lowers the quality level of treatment, but also lowers the level of effectiveness, may well cause wear on the component, plus there is in addition an evident heating up of the work-pieces, owing to friction. When you are using thin pieces, it is increased heat (and the relating flexibility of the metal) that may cause elements to bend, warp or distort. Usually, it takes a professional technician to look at all of these points to equally not cause harm to the workpiece and to operate efficiently. In order to appreciably increase the standard of the finished surface, the polishing action should really be accomplished with significantly less vigour and not a large amount of pressure so as to subsequently complete a surface that is free of scratches or marks as a consequence of the buffing process, thus ending up with a shiny mirror finish.
